Learn more about Sussex

Known as the 'Covered Bridge Capital,' Sussex delights visitors with eight historic covered bridges perfect for scenic drives and photography. Explore the Sussex Murals depicting local history, then time your visit for the Atlantic Balloon Fiesta where dozens of colourful hot air balloons fill the sky.

Things to do in and around Sussex

Sussex, New Brunswick, is perfect for outdoor enthusiasts and adventure seekers. The area boasts popular attractions such as ski fields, fairgrounds, and opportunities for leisurely wanderings. Visitors can indulge in the pleasures of Sussex, enjoy friendly attractions, and even take part in tennis coaching. With its stunning scenery and a range of activities, Sussex offers an inviting vacation experience for all.

Shopping

In Sussex, you can shop at Gateway Mall and Sussex Place Mall, both offering a variety of shops with a family-friendly atmosphere. If you're up for a drive, consider visiting nearby markets for unique local crafts and souvenirs.

Recreation

Experience the lush greens and fresh air at Sussex Golf & Curling Club, a perfect spot for golf enthusiasts just 4.8km from Sussex. For relaxation, Melvin Beach offers a tranquil retreat 24.8km away, ideal for unwinding by the water. Hampton Golf Club, 35.4km away, invites you to enjoy more outdoor sports.

Adventure

Poley Mountain, located 11.3km from Sussex, offers thrilling skiing experiences amidst a vibrant sports atmosphere. For hiking enthusiasts, the Fundy Trail Parkway, 35.4km away, presents breathtaking outdoor adventures with stunning scenery that showcases the natural beauty of New Brunswick.

Nightlife

Explore the vibrant nightlife at The Sussex Drive-In for a unique movie experience under the stars. For a lively atmosphere, visit The Olde Country Inn on Main Street for great food and local brews, or enjoy a laid-back evening at the Sussex Farmers Market during special events.

Find the best attractions in Sussex

Sussex, New Brunswick, is a fantastic destination for outdoor enthusiasts and families seeking adventure and scenic beauty. Key attractions include urban parks, a fairground showground, and a military museum. Visitors can also enjoy the vibrant Sussex murals and explore the nearby South Downs. With a variety of activities and experiences, Sussex offers something for everyone looking to immerse themselves in local culture and nature.

  • Princess Louise Park Show Centre: Enjoy a vibrant fairground atmosphere at the Princess Louise Park Show Centre, perfect for families. Experience outdoor events, live entertainment, and local festivities, making it a delightful spot to create lasting memories in Sussex.
  • 8th Hussars Regimental Museum: Dive into the rich military history at the 8th Hussars Regimental Museum. Featuring fascinating exhibits, this museum showcases the culture and heritage of the esteemed 8th Hussars, offering a unique insight into Canada's military past.
  • Barbour's Park: Embrace the beauty of nature at Barbour's Park, an urban oasis in Sussex. Ideal for families, this park features walking trails, picnic areas, and recreational facilities, providing a relaxing retreat amidst the city's hustle and bustle.

Best time to go to Sussex

The best time to visit Sussex is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Sussex

To visit Sussex, New Brunswick, you can fly into three major airports. Greater Moncton International Airport (YQM) is located 75.6km away, with nearby hotels like the 4.5-star Chateau Moncton, Wild Rose Inn, and Wingate by Wyndham Dieppe, all offering convenient access. Greater Fredericton International Airport (YFC) is 82.1km from Sussex, featuring options such as the 4.5-star Chateau Fredericton and Crowne Plaza Fredericton-Lord Beaverbrook, both 12.9km from the airport. Lastly, Saint John Airport (YSJ) is 53.1km away, with excellent hotels like the 4.5-star Chateau Saint John and Hampton Inn & Suites, located 7 to 14.5km from the airport.

When is the best time to go to Sussex?
The best time to visit Sussex, New Brunswick, for pleasant weather and outdoor activities is during the summer months, from June to August.

During this period, the weather is typically warm and sunny, making it ideal for exploring the local area and enjoying outdoor pursuits. You'll find that all local attractions, including the famous covered bridges and the agricultural exhibitions, are fully operational and easily accessible. This is also when many local festivals and events take place, offering a lively experience.

For those who prefer slightly cooler temperatures and fewer crowds, late spring (May) and early autumn (September to early October) are also excellent choices. The landscape during these times is particularly scenic, with spring blossoms or autumn colours creating beautiful backdrops for photography and leisurely drives through the countryside.
